The sloppy relationship between neural circuit structure and function
1Institute for Adaptive and Neural Computation, School of Informatics, University of Edinburgh, Edinburgh, Scotland.
Neural circuit structure and function are closely linked, but parameters can be unstable. Neural manifolds help stabilize function by restricting activity to relevant subspaces, despite parameter variability.

Background:
- A long-standing hypothesis in neuroscience posits a strong link between neural circuit structure and function.
- Neural circuits develop complex structures and modify synapses for memory, suggesting structure dictates function.
- Recent findings challenge this by showing function weakly constrains circuit parameters, many of which are irrelevant or unstable.
Purpose of the Study:
- To reconcile the apparent contradiction between unstable circuit parameters and robust functional dynamics.
- To explore how neural circuit function is maintained despite structural variability.
- To investigate the role of neural manifolds in stabilizing functionally relevant activity.
Main Methods:
- Analysis of neural circuit dynamics and parameters.
- Theoretical modeling of neural manifolds.
- Investigating the relationship between parameter space properties and functional robustness.
Main Results:
- Neural circuit activity related to function demonstrates robustness over time and across individuals.
- Despite parameter instability, neural manifolds restrict circuit activity to functionally relevant subspaces.
- Degenerate, anisotropic, and unstable parameter spaces are associated with the implementation of neural manifolds.
Conclusions:
- Neural manifolds provide a mechanism for robust function in the face of structural variability.
- The apparent contradiction is resolved by understanding how manifolds shape circuit dynamics.
- Degenerate parameter spaces are crucial for implementing functionally relevant neural manifolds.
